logo

Output 37d3104fd594c790049e54a026cb256cc714b18a979de9544982c37976adbf8b:0

value
16603928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31bf869f447baf2db375c2c8ed2e6deeedf5a036 OP_EQUAL
address
36E4UPomYE1TyRKHVt8LA8y4wCsQAqEotL
transaction
37d3104fd594c790049e54a026cb256cc714b18a979de9544982c37976adbf8b